Englund’s financial acumen is perhaps most evident in his transition from a primarily acting-focused career to that of a veteran entertainer and entrepreneur. He understood early on that his unique visage and imposing physique were assets that could be leveraged beyond acting. A significant portion of his net worth can be attributed to relentless and strategic public appearances, conventions, and voice work. For decades, he has been a staple at horror conventions around the world. These events are major revenue generators, involving appearance fees, ticket sales, and, most importantly, the sale of high-priced merchandise and autographs. The demand for Robert Englund at these conventions is immense, allowing him to command substantial appearance fees that dwarf a standard acting gig. Furthermore, his collaboration with specialized companies like Classic Media and Sideshow Collectibles has been instrumental. He has been the face of officially licensed action figures, posters, and collectibles, creating a passive income stream that operates independently of his daily work. He has also ventured into producing and directing, taking on roles behind the camera to maintain creative control and open additional revenue channels. This business-savvy approach to his legacy has transformed him from a simple character actor into a thriving brand. His net worth is a testament not only to his ability to scare audiences but also to his ability to successfully market that fear into a lasting and lucrative career.

The foundation of her wealth is, of course, rooted in the reality television series "Keeping Up with the Kardashians." For over a decade, this show provided the raw material—her family life, her relationships, her struggles, and her triumphs—that captivated millions of viewers. The salary from this show was significant, reportedly earning her tens of millions per season at its peak. However, Kim quickly realized that confining her value to a television screen was a severe limitation. She was merely a character on a show; she needed to become a brand. This epiphany led to the strategic expansion into the world of endorsements and sponsorships. In the early 2010s, she became a master of the paid partnership, seamlessly integrating products like Coca-Cola, Pepsi, and countless beauty brands into her public persona. She didn't just use these products; she became the product, and her social media feed became a lucrative billboard. The sheer volume of these deals, often running into six figures per post, accumulated at an astonishing rate, solidifying her status as one of the highest-paid influencers in the world long before the term achieved mainstream ubiquity.
